
NEW YORKÂ – An airplane headed to Westchester County Airport has disappeared after losing communication with the air traffic control tower, as reported by police and local news outlets.
The aircraft, a small single-engine plane, was approaching the airport around 5:30 p.m. on Thursday when contact was lost, according to the Westchester County Police.
The plane has a capacity of six passengers, but it is unclear how many people were on board at the time communication was lost.
A search is currently being conducted in the vicinity of the airport.
